The effects of coffee consumption on health have long been a subject of conflict and uncertainty. Since the 1980s, some have spoken out against coffee as it’s harmful to health, while others have welcomed coffee for its supposed benefits to health.According to a scientific report, mild coffee consumption, three to five cups per day, can be taken as a healthy dietary pattern, along with other healthful behavior. The report also says that coffee consumption helps reduce the risk of heart disease and it protects against Parkinson’s disease.According to Dr. Donald Hensrud of Mayo Clinic, high consumption of coffee has health risks. Dr. Hensrud mentions the dangers of high coffee consumption for people with a certain illness that slows the breakdown of caffeine in the body. Some studies said that drinking two or more cups of coffee daily can actually increase the risk of heart disease in these people.According to conclusions from a recent study led by Dr. Gregory Marcus, a doctor from the University of California, San Francisco, daily moderate consumption of caffeine, less than 4 cups, is not associated with these issues.Until the scientific community reaches a general agreement on the effects of coffee consumption on human health, it will be up to the individual to decide whether the benefits of drinking coffee are greater than the risks.When informed of these possible health benefits and harm of drinking coffee, Harwood, a high school student stated, “Even though there might be some negative effects of drinking coffee, for the most part, coffee drinking sounds good for health. 题组提分练14 Unit 4 Astronomy the science of the stars 限时35分钟加黑体小题训练推断判断题之写作意图题阅读理解A(原创) 体裁:说明文话题:世界与环境难度:★★★☆☆Scientists recently announced the discovery of a small, birdlike dinosaur from China which had unusual, colorful feathers. The scientists named the colorful dinosaur Caihong, which lived 161 million years ago during the Jurassic Period of earth's history, the Mandarin word for rainbow. Chad Eliason is an evolutionary biologist with the Field Museum in Chicago, Illinois. He helped write the study announcing the discovery in the scientific publication Nature Communications. Eliason told the Reuters news service that the discovery “suggests a more colorful Jurassic World than we previously im agined.”The scientists used powerful microscopes to identify the remains of the cell structures responsible for the apparent color of the feathers. The shape of those structures appears to have influenced what color the feathers would have. Roundshaped s tructures in the Caihong fossil show that it had feathers similar to that of a modernday hummingbird.The dinosaur had many birdlike qualities. But researchers doubt if it could actually fly. Its feathers could have served the purpose of gaining the attention of sexual partners while also providing protection from heat and cold. Caihong was twolegged and had a long, narrow head with sharp teeth. It had boney crests above its eyes, and it hunted other smaller animals for food.Scientists say many dinosaurs had feathers. Birds evolved from small feathered dinosaurs near the end of the Jurassic Period. Caihong had two kinds of feathers, and was the earliestknown creature with feathers that did not have the same shape on both sides. This is a physicalquality that modern birds have and use to direct themselves while flying.The unevenly shaped feathers on Caihong were on its tail. 阅读理解B(原创) 体裁:说明文话题:社会难度:★★☆☆☆The traditional Chinese lunar calendar divides the year into 24 solar terms. Winter Solstice (冬至), the 22nd solar term of the year, begins this year on Dec.22 and ends on Jan. 5.On the first day of Winter Solstice, the Northern Hemisphere experiences the shortest day and the longest night in the year, as the sun shines directly at the Tropic of Capricorn. From then on, the days become longer and the nights become shorter. The Winter Solstice also marks the arrival of the coldest season in the year.There was a saying that went in ancient China, “The Winter Solstice is as significant as the Spring Festival.” As early as the Zhou Dynasty (c.11th century—256BC), people celebrated the first day of the Winter Solstice, which was also the first day of the new year. The Winter Solstice became a winter festival during the Han Dynasty (206BC—220AD). The celebratory activities were officially organized. On this day, both officials and ordinary people would have a rest. During subsequent (随后的) dynasties, such as the Tang (618-907), Song (960-1279) and Qing dynasties (1644-1911), the Winter Solstice was a day to offer sacrifices to Heaven and to ancestors.During Winter Solstice in North China, eating dumplings is essential to the festival. There is a saying that goes “Have dumplings on the first day of Winter Solstice and noodles on the first day of Summer Solstice.” People in Suzhou, Jiangsu Province, are accustomed to eating wontons (馄饨) in midwinter. According to a legend, during the midwinter feast 2,500 years ago, the King of Wu was tired of all costly foods and wanted to eat something different. Then, the beauty Xishi made “wontons” for the king. He ate a lot and liked the food very much. In memory of Xishi, the people of Suzhou made wontons the official food to celebrate the festival.During the Winter Solstice, Hangzhou residents traditionally eat rice cakes.
